Output ed33f83a4a33a51e877dfd144101e06b44136949320e99c6c6f107a235267a9f:0

value
12278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2045488b88e5c04ab08ff3e5345b49c5d4cdf48 OP_EQUAL
address
3GTgaVJ1HJjGT5qMyjWXhLtYSY9D2o9VWr
transaction
ed33f83a4a33a51e877dfd144101e06b44136949320e99c6c6f107a235267a9f
confirmations
55620
spent
true